How Our Crawl Space Water Removal Process Works
Our process is designed to get you back to normal as quickly and efficiently as possible. We understand that every minute counts when dealing with water damage. That’s why we’ll work tirelessly to extract the water, dry the space, and prevent future damage. Here’s what you can expect from our team: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ive on-site to assess the damage and create a customized plan to tackle the issue. Our technicians will identify the source of the leak, assess the extent of the damage, and find out the best course of action. We’ll work with you to understand your concerns and develop a plan that meets your needs.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use high-powered p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your crawl space.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ce the disruption to your daily life. Our technicians are trained to handle even the toughest water removal jobs.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ry the space and remove any excess moisture.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age. Our team will work tirelessly to ensure the space is dry and safe for you to enter.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to remove any dirt, debris, or bacteria. Our technicians will use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as. We’ll replace any damaged materials, including drywall, insulation, and flooring. Our goal is to restore your home to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Removal
Crawl space water damage can be sneaky, but there are warning signs to look out for.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to watch out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Musty odors in your crawl space can show moisture buildup.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s time to call our team. We’ll identify the source of the issue and provide a solution to get your space fresh and clean again.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leak in your crawl space. Don’t ignore these stains, they can lead to bigger problems like structural damage or mold growth. Our team will work quickly to identify and fix the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show moisture damage in your crawl space. If you notice these issues, it’s time to call our team. We’ll assess the damage and provide a solution to get your floors back to normal.
Unusual Sounds or Sights
Unusual sounds or sights in your crawl space can show moisture buildup or other issues. If you notice anything out of the ordinary, it’s time to call our team. We’ll investigate and provide a solution to get your space safe and secure.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th in your crawl space can be a serious health hazard. If you notice any growth, it’s time to call our team. We’ll assess the issue and provide a solution to get your space clean and safe again.
Increased Energy Bills
Increased energy bills can show moisture buildup in your crawl space. If you notice a spike in your energy bills, it’s time to call our team. We’ll assess the issue and provide a solution to get your space energy-efficient again.

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Scranton, KS
The cost of crawl space water removal can vary depending on the severity and size of the issue, as well as local conditions in Scranton, KS. Our estimates are based on the specifics of your job and will be provided after an on-site assessment. Here are some general price ranges to exp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the amount of water present, and the level of damage |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ials needed, and the labor required |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end calls) | $200 – $1,000 | The time of day or day of the week, the level of urgency, and the complexity of the issue |
| More services (mold remediation, structural repair) | $500 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ials needed, and the labor required |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and the specifics of your job. We offer free estimates and will work with you to provide a customized solution that meets your needs and budget.
